let's solve for x :
first step : adding 7 on both sides
- [tex]9x - 7 = 10[/tex]
- [tex]9x - 7 + 7 = 10 + 7[/tex]
- [tex]9x = 17[/tex]
next step : dividing by 9 on both sides :
- [tex] \dfrac{9x}{9} = \dfrac{17}{9} [/tex]
- [tex]x = \dfrac{17}{9} [/tex]
now, let's check for the solution by Plugging the value of x as 17 / 9 in the above equation.
- [tex]9x - 7 = 10[/tex]
- [tex](9 \times \dfrac{17}{9} ) - 7 = 10[/tex]
- [tex]17 - 7 = 10[/tex]
- [tex]10 = 10[/tex]
we can see that the LHS = RHS, therefore our value for x is correct. i.e 17 / 9
